fix(rate-limit): 退避延长至 6h 且登录路径同样遵守,打破 Garmin 限流死循环

根因:迁移后自动同步+旧 oauth2 刷新轰炸把 Garmin 账号撞进限流黑洞;退避原仅 60min 且登录路径完全不检查,导致每小时退避到期又撞一次 429、登录也直接连 Garmin 被 429,窗口永远退不出。

- garmin.py: RATE_LIMIT_BACKOFF 60min->6h;_note_rate_limit 改为固定 now+6h(不再短延期)。
- garmin_auth.py: _run_login 入口先查 rate_limited_until 拦截(不撞 Garmin),遇 429 也调 _note_rate_limit 延长退避。
- 已在生产把 sync_status.rate_limited_until 设到 now+6h,强制 Garmin 安静以让窗口真正关闭。
